Key Financial Performance

Revenue $25.6 million for the first quarter of fiscal year 2026, compared to $37.2 million in the same period last year, a decrease of 31%. The decline was attributed to lower demand in various segments, including Hydroconn cable and connector products, and reduced utilization of the OBX rental fleet.

Net Loss $9.8 million for the first quarter of fiscal year 2026, compared to a net income of $8.4 million in the same period last year. The shift to a loss was due to reduced revenue and increased costs driven by inflation, tariffs, and supply chain challenges.

Smart Water Segment Revenue $5.8 million for the first quarter of fiscal year 2026, compared to $7.3 million in the same period last year, a decrease of 21%. The decline was due to lower demand for Hydroconn cable and connector products.

Energy Solutions Segment Revenue $14.6 million for the first quarter of fiscal year 2026, compared to $24.3 million in the same period last year, a decrease of 40%. The decline was due to the absence of a $17 million OBX marine wireless product sale from the prior year and lower utilization of the OBX rental fleet.

Intelligent Industrial Segment Revenue $5.1 million for the first quarter of fiscal year 2026, compared to $5.6 million in the same period last year, a decrease of 8%. The decline was primarily due to lower demand for industrial sensor products, partially offset by increased demand for contract manufacturing services.

Cash and Cash Equivalents $10 million as of December 31, 2025. No year-over-year comparison provided.

Working Capital $52.2 million as of December 31, 2025, including $25.4 million of trade accounts and financing receivables. No year-over-year comparison provided.

Operating Highlights

GeoVox Security acquisition: Strengthened security portfolio with the acquisition of GeoVox Security, which includes a human heartbeat detection algorithm. Introduced a monthly subscription model to simplify procurement.

Smart Water segment expansion: Expanding geographic reach of sales and marketing operations to address demand driven by population growth, urbanization, and aging infrastructure.

Cost management and capital discipline: Prioritized safe and reliable operations, managed costs carefully, and maintained capital discipline to strengthen strategic position.

Diversification and innovation: Invested in innovative technology to diversify business and drive sustainable growth.

Risk or Challenges

Economic Uncertainty: The company operates in an environment shaped by economic uncertainty, which has impacted its performance and financial results.

Inflation and Material Costs: Inflation has driven up material costs faster than the company could adjust pricing, negatively affecting margins.

Tariffs: Tariffs have impacted margins, adding to the financial challenges faced by the company.

Supply Chain Challenges: Supply chain disruptions have forced the company to carry higher inventory costs, affecting operational efficiency.

Smart Water Segment Challenges: The segment faces rising operating costs, climate-related variability, evolving compliance requirements, and the need for sustained capital investment.

Energy Solutions Segment Volatility: The segment is affected by geopolitical events, inflationary pressures, regulatory developments, and fluctuating commodity prices, leading to ongoing volatility.

Revenue Decline in Key Segments: Revenue in the Smart Water, Energy Solutions, and Intelligent Industrial segments has decreased compared to the previous year, driven by lower demand and reduced utilization of rental fleets.

Lower Demand for Specific Products: The company has experienced lower demand for Hydroconn cable and connector products, industrial sensor products, and OBX marine wireless products.

Seasonal and Budgetary Impacts: Revenue in the Smart Water segment was reduced due to seasonal deployment schedules and the timing of municipal government budget cycles.

Capital Expenditure Constraints: The company does not anticipate additions to the rental fleet given current market conditions, which may limit growth opportunities.

Guidance & Outlook

Smart Water Segment: Long-term demand for water infrastructure, treatment, and management services remains strong, driven by population growth, urbanization, aging infrastructure, and heightened regulatory and environmental standards. The company is expanding the geographic reach of its sales and marketing operations to areas with acute demand and where its technology offers significant value.

Energy Solutions Segment: The company anticipates additional sales of its Pioneer land node solution later this year. The long-term fundamentals of the energy industry remain intact, but success requires caution, adaptability, and operational excellence.

Intelligent Industrial Segment: The recurring revenue model, bolstered by the acquisition of GeoVox Security and the introduction of a monthly subscription model, positions the segment for growth in 2026 and beyond.

Capital Expenditures: Management anticipates a capital expenditure budget of $5 million for fiscal year 2026 and does not plan to add to the rental fleet given current market conditions.

Overall Outlook: The company expects continued uncertainty in global markets but believes it is well-positioned due to its portfolio quality, experienced workforce, and conservative financial framework. It will continue to evaluate opportunities carefully, avoid speculative investments, and focus on long-term shareholder value.

Key Q&A

Q:Can you talk about the strategic importance of the heartbeat installed base? Specifically, when should we expect a meaningful portion of those contracts to come up for renewal? And if that installed base were fully subscription-based today, what would be the implied annual recurring revenue?
A:The historical installed base equipment is aging, and there is interest in replacing it with the new subscription model. However, the base is diverse and international. Management has not run numbers for a 100% replacement scenario and could not provide a specific answer, though they mentioned there are several hundred installed bases.
Q:Did you bid on the Homeland Security RFP for a persistent surveillance detection system for 15 miles?
A:The U.S. government issued a direct award for the contract to expedite the process, and the company was not awarded it. There is no expectation of a further RFP.
Q:What is the timeline for the deployment of the Petrobras contract, and how will revenues be reflected over time?
A:Revenue recognition will follow an overtime model, similar to percentage completion. Revenue will begin in Q3, with the goods portion expected to be completed in Q1 2027. Additional revenue from installation services will be recognized later in 2027. The total contract value is approximately $90 million, with the majority attributed to goods.
Q:What is the anticipated revenue level for Q3 and Q4 from the Petrobras contract?
A:Management did not provide specific revenue figures but indicated that revenue would ramp up, starting lower in Q3, reaching full capacity in Q4, and tapering off by the end of Q1 2027. The revenue curve will resemble a curve rather than a fixed number.
Q:Can you provide a detailed update on GeoVox deployments and the pipeline?
A:The company started shipping GeoVox units this quarter, with revenue recognition beginning this quarter. They anticipate deploying a couple of hundred units this year, with growth in subsequent periods. The market size is in the thousands, and they aim to reach a saturable level in the next few years. Current markets include prisons, jails, border crossings, and secured sites like nuclear facilities.
Q:What is the Border Patrol's interest in GeoVox, and how large could the market be?
A:Border Patrol is interested in the technology to increase efficiency and effectiveness. There are approximately 300 border crossing points in the U.S., and the market could involve 1,000+ units for CBP.
Q:Which business was the $196,000 increase in contingent consideration related to?
A:The increase in contingent consideration was related to the Heartbeat Detector business.
Q:What are the prospects for the rental fleet seeing increased activity levels?
A:The ocean bottom node business is expected to remain flat this year. While there have been more requests for quotations, none have developed into orders yet.
Q:Can you disclose the number of parties you have ongoing discussions with for PRM, excluding Petrobras?
A:Management could not disclose specific parties due to confidentiality but mentioned they are in discussions with multiple parties.
